  • Page 10 Hot water at 60°C can severely burn a child in less than a second. At 50°C it takes five minutes. Always test the temperature of the water before any use. To prevent these risks, Rinnai reccomends to consider setting your hot water production at a maximum temperature of 50°C.

  • Page 12: Selectable Temperatures

    The appliance is set at the factory to allow the selection of a maximum temperature of 50°C. This limit is generally more than adequate for most of the domestic uses, but it is possible to modify it according to your needs. A Rinnai specialized technician can modify the device electronics by modifying the maximum allowed temperature, bringing it to a higher value or limiting it further.

  • Page 30: Remote Controller

    2.8 REMOTE CONTROLLER A standard remote controller (MC-601) is supplied as a standard together with any outdoor model water heater. The indoor models are supplied with a non-removable controller on the front panel. However, it is possible to add up to three additional remote controllers on both product ranges (outdoor and indoor), to be able to adjust the temperature of the hot water from different areas.

  • Page 35: Recirculation Mode

    2.11 RECIRCULATION MODE The Rinnai Infi nity SENSEI Series water heater has the ability to control a recirculation pump (optional), with a connection cable supplied separately. With this optional mode is possible recirculate the water in the plumbing system to provide hot water quickly when a tap is opened.
